Step 1: Containment and Assessment
We’ll seal off the affected area with heavy-duty barriers to prevent cross-contamination and protect your belongings. Our team will then conduct a thorough assessment to identify the root cause of the infestation and create a personalized treatment plan.
Step 2: Equipment Setup and Treatment
We’ll set up high-velocity air movers and industrial-grade d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process. Our certified technicians will then apply the specialized treatment, using a combination of microbial-killing agents and odor-neutralizing products to remove the antimicrobial growth.
Step 3: Drying and Cleanup
Once the treatment is complete, we’ll begin the drying process using industrial-grade fans and temperature-control units. Our team will then th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area, removing any remaining debris and stains.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Certification
After the treatment and drying process is complete, our certified technicians will con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ure the area is safe and free from antimicrobial growth.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you’ve tried cleaning and deodorizing, but the smell persists, it’s time to call in the professionals. Our Antimicrobial Treatment Services will remove the source of the odor and leave your home smelling fresh and clean.
Visible Mold or Mildew Growth
Don’t wait until the problem spreads. If you’ve noticed black spots, greenish fuzz, or slimy growth on your wal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s time to act. Our certified technicians will contain the affected area and apply a specialized treatment to remove the antimicrobial growth.
Water Damage or Leaks
Water damage or leaks can create a perfect environment for antimicrobial growth. If you’ve experienced a water event or noticed signs of water damage, contact us immediately. We’ll work quickly to contain the area, dry the space, and apply a treatment to prevent future infestations.
Unexplained Allergies or Respiratory Issues
Antimicrobial growth can release spores into the air, exacerbating allergies and respiratory issues. If you or a family member is experiencing unexplained symptoms, it’s possible that antimicrobial growth is the culprit. Our Antimicrobial Treatment Services can help remove the source of the problem and improve indoor air quality.
Discoloration or Warping of Building Materials
Antimicrobial growth can cause discoloration or warping of building materials, including drywall, wood, and insulation. |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small area treatment (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| $500 – $1,500 | Size and severity of infestation, presence of water damage or leaks |
| Medium area treatment (100-500 sq. Ft.) | $1,000 – $3,500 | Size and severity of infestation, presence of water damage or leaks, number of rooms affected |
| Large area treatment (500-1,500 sq. Ft.) | $2,000 – $6,000 | Size and severity of infestation, presence of water damage or leaks, number of rooms affected, complexity of job |
| Extensive area treatment (over 1,500 sq. Ft.) | $3,000 – $10,000 or more | Size and severity of infestation, presence of water damage or leaks, number of rooms affected, complexity of job, number of technicians required |
| More services (e.g., drywall repair, painting) | $500 – $2,000 or more | Scope of work, number of materials required, labor costs |

Q: What causes antimicrobial growth in my home?
A: Antimicrobial growth can be caused by a variety of factors, including water damage or leaks, poor ventilation, high humidity, or the presence of organic materials. Our certified technicians will assess your situation and provide a personalized treatment plan to remove the source of the problem.
Q: Will I need to vacate my home during the treatment process?
A: In most cases, no. Our treatment process is designed to reduce disruption to your daily life. But, in some cases, we may recommend temporary relocation to ensure your safety and the effectiveness of the treatment.
Q: Can I prevent antimicrobial growth from returning after treatment?
A: Yes. Our certified technicians will provide guidance on maintaining a healthy home environment and preventing future infestations. This may include recommendations for improving ventilation, reducing humidity, and addressing any underlying water damage or leaks.
